In Memoriam
Ananda Zaren
It
is with great sadness that we report that renowned homeopath Ananda
Zaren has passed away due to injuries sustained during a car accident
on Saturday September 20, 2008

Ananda had been practicing homeopathy since 1977. She studied with
George Vithoulkas extensively both in Europe and in the United States.
Since 1987, Ananda taught in England, Norway, Holland, Israel, Germany,
Switzerland, New Zealand, Australia, Belgium and India. In 1989
she started supervising homeopaths in Detmold, Germany and Zurich,
Switzerland, and in the U.S. in 1991.
Ananda attended and presented at the 1st World Congress in Berlin,
Germany and the 1st World Congress on Chronic Disease in Frankfurt,
Germany. In April 2000 she gave a presentation at the 2nd World
Congress on Chronic Disease in Stuttgart, Germany. She was a keynote
speaker for the National Center for Homeopathy in 1998 in the U.S.
During 2001 Ananda supervised fellow homeopaths with their various
cases in Germany, Switzerland and the United States. In 2001 and
2002 she presented for the University of California, Santa Barbara.
Ananda taught a three-year program training homeopaths in Santa
Barbara and taught internationally twice during 2006. She was the
author of two textbooks entitled Core Elements of the Materia Medica
of the Mind, Volumes I and II. She developed a unique clinical method
known as the Wound, Wall and Mask, described in her books. She will
be missed by all.
